Stacy, thanks for taking the time to share your stories with us today Can you tell us the backstory behind how you came up with the idea?
Actually, the idea and concept of Stacy O Designs was an easy choice. It was an extension of what I already did for many years. However, my first job is Mom. My current business was created to be able to raise my children, drive them to school, attend their sports events and spend weekend quality time with them.
Let’s backtrack a minute and I’ll tell you about my past.
-I have an undergrad in Audio Engineering, a Masters in New Media and a Master’s degree in Business Administration.
-I spent 15 years as a Digital Media Specialist in Medical Education, up in NY. In this ever evolving role, and a very forward thinking supervisor, I jumped into all of the new technology; which at the time was the internet. I learned web design, created streaming video on demand, and graphics for online marketing and social media.
-Fast forward: moved to Florida – I became the Creative Director at a digital marketing agency where I really was able to put all of my degrees and experience to functional use.
Ok, on with the story.
During lock down, I found myself laid off, and no one was hiring. I started freelancing and building websites and marketing materials for local businesses that were trying to beat the odds during that time.
Eventually, those businesses wanted physical marketing materials, so I started my printing business. From there it’s all been uphill! I have created a nice home based business (mostly through word of mouth) printing custom shirts, signs, cups, etc. Businesses need branded merch!
I have also expanded into retail sales for individuals. People want custom! So combining my graphic design skills with printing, I am filling a niche that people are hungry for.
Along with this, I still offer digital services such as logo design, business branding and custom graphics.

How about pivoting – can you share the story of a time you’ve had to pivot?
I have actually pivoted quite a few times in my career. I had a solid, reliable 9-5 for a long time in New York. Once we started having children, my husband and I thought long and hard what kind of life we wanted while raising them. We decided to leave that stability and move down to Florida. I helped my husband open up his business, then I started employment at a Digital Marketing Agency. I chose this because it was about 1 mile from my children’s school and very flexible. Covid hit – pivot again. I was laid off and decided to start my own business. The deeper I got into working for myself, the more I realized this is what I wanted for my family.
People always ask “what is your ‘why’?” My why is my family, every day, all day. Yes, I’m up early sending out emails. Yes I’m up late finishing up projects, but in between I have watched my kids thrive.
I feel like my business is able to change and evolve as my kids get older and more independent. It has taken years to establish my company, but now that we are in this ‘gig economy’, people are searching out the services I provide.

Do you have multiple revenue streams – if so, can you talk to us about those streams and how your developed them?
I learned about multiple streams of revenue a long time ago, and it’s a MUST nowadays. It took me a while to build them up, but now I see them paying off monthly, and I am so thankful I put the work in.
Backstory – when I first got into printing, (I do sublimation mostly) I was mentored by a wonderful woman who taught me everything she knows. Because of my graphic design background and just the general knowledge of computers I had, I was able to pick it quickly,…and excel at it. So I decided to pass that kindness on to others beginning their journey, and started a YouTube channel. At the start, it was rough. I didn’t have a proper space, no lighting and shooting on my phone. But I did it!
Over the years my production quality has gone up and I have a few sponsors and do affiliate marketing for them. So, over 600,000 views later I am still making videos, but also making money on the ones from the beginning.
Starting this was a huge hurdle for me. I was always behind the camera; shooting, editing, producing,.. whatever. I just had to get over being self conscious and put on my teaching hat. And you know what, people loved it!
I would often shoot client projects I was working on and people would comment as to where they could get the images I was printing. So I started to offer my digital images on Etsy. There is an unbelievable amount of competition there, but it is another stream that is doing well for me.
